#daebb5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#daebb5 is composed of 85.5% red, 92.2% green and 71%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 23%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 78.9 degrees, a saturation of 57.4% and a lightness of 81.6%. #daebb5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b5d76b. Closest websafe color is: #ccffcc.

Shades and Tints of #daebb5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020301 is the darkest color, while #f9fcf3 is the lightest one.
